BiP is a recently introduced communication application from Nepal. CG Lifecell, a part of Chaudhary Group Nepal, recently launched BiP messenger Nepal in partnership with Turkish company Turkcell. BiP app allows you to place voice calls, video calls, messaging and file sharing. Besides this basic messaging, the app is also capable to let users get information regarding exchange rates, weather, and news. CG Lifecell recently launched BiP application with the purpose of spreading information dissemination. With this, Chaudhary Group has extended itself in the field of Information Technology. IME Pay, powered by IME Remit is one of the leading payment gateways in Nepal. IME Pay launched its first app on March 10, 2017, becoming the first Digital Wallet to get the license as a Payment Service Provider from Nepal Rastra Bank. The payment gateway has now come up with IME Pay Reward Points system. Recently the app came with a much-requested Reward Points feature where users now will get reward points while making payments and redeem the points with money. Nepal Telecom, a state-owned telecommunication provider collaborates with Rastriya Banijya Bank to provide Mobile Money Service.Nepal Telecom does not have a license for the financial transaction so they were planning to partner with the company having Payment Service license provide and finally now they have decided to form a subsidiary company for cashless payment partnering with Rastriya Banijya Bank which is Government-owned commercial bank. The Mobile Money Service can be made available to all mobile service subscribers having smartphones as well as feature phones.
